bad nose smell

What causes a person to seem to always smell everything sour. I don't seem to be able to smell things the same. For the last year, I have had periods when everything smells sour. At first I thought it was my own body, but it is not. Then I realized that it is my nose.  Everything has a sour smell.  Sometimes it makes me nauseated.  Should I see an ENT or some kind of neurological specialist? The only medication I take on a regular basis is Synthroid 1.5.  I am 62 years old and am female.
242587_tn?1355427710
It is possible that there is an infection in your nose or sinuses which is causing this sour smell.  I would suggest seeing your family physician to look into your nose and evaluate the situation to see if there is an obvious cause.
